What exactly Does Final Expense Insurance Cover?
Burial insurance covers your funeral expenses, as you could have guessed in the name. This includes obvious things like purchasing your final resting place, purchasing the coffin (or cremation prices), paying for your own funeral service, and buying a headstone.
Other lesser known costs that can often be covered are things like grave digging and floral arrangements. They’re not substantial on their very own, however they’re able to add up fast.
For an unprepared family who might not have a lot of disposable income, these prices (which could run into the tens of thousands of dollars) can be a serious shock. Many families turn to banks to get loans, being in debt to pay the funeral costs of a loved one is not a nice feeling off. Particularly when you’re attempting to grieve.
How Much Final Expense Insurance Cost?
So as we hope you will concur by this time, protecting your family from these costs that are large and sudden is something that needs to be considered near essential. When” not “if”, death is inescapable, it’s very much a case of “.
Costs for burial insurance strategies differ dramatically between suppliers. Some basic coverage plans can start from just a couple dollars weekly, however there are exceptionally complete strategies that cost more.
Better coverage requires higher fees however as you can imagine.
Most payments are made monthly, but there are a few plans that take weekly payments too.
The sum you need to pay is largely determined by how old you are. The old you’re, the more your premiums will be. It’s economics that is simple really if you’re mathematically closer to death, you’re planning to should cover more over a shorter amount of time. On account of their lifespans that are statistically shorter, men often cover more for final expense insurance than girls.

Your health also plays a big part in your premiums. If you might have a history of serious health issues, your premium will be higher. It is useful to realize that insurance companies that are different have different standards. So if you do have health issues, it pays to search around.
So do your research, there will probably be a big difference in quality between insurers and see which supplier provides you with the perfect balance between price and coverage.
